This may seem like a silly question, but for those who think ""outside the box"" it matters.

Players Hand Book - P.130 said:
Spell Component Pouch: This small, watertight leather belt pouch has many compartments. A spellcaster with a spell component pouch is assumed to have all the material components and focuses needed for spellcasting, except for those components that have a specific cost, divine focuses, and focuses that wouldn't fir in a pouch.
How do you rule a spell component pouch stays stocked - is it assumed and not mentioned that the caster is always stopping and picking (sometimes literally) up crap, or do you rule (maybe in a magic heavy world) that it stays magically stocked?

I assume they collect the odds and ends on a daily basis. Adventuring in a cave? Grab some bat guano. Outside? Grab a pinch of dust. At a halfling trader's camp? I bet they have a bit of wire I can have for a copper.

That is a good one and depends on how you run your game.

IMC - it is done behind the scenes. I assume the caster is adding things as he goes (like how a wizard does the research to gain his 2 new spells per level).

In a game I'm playing in (and running a sorcerer) - the DM is "talking" about having to restock the items. Now I don't know what that means yer but will find out as soon as I can. I have a feeling that he is pretty much going to nix the spell component pouch (as written) and make me have to "find" and "acquire" the components. Which is fine, but I think it iwrong to add that to the the cost of the item itself. At 5 gp it costs more than a back pack.

The answer to this one is clearly no.

For 2 reasons.

1. A crossbow bolt has a specific cost (1 gp/10 bolts)

2. They wouldn't fit in the pouch.

Spell Component Pouch: A spellcaster with a spell component pouch is assumed to have all the material components and focuses needed for spellcasting, except for those components that have a specific cost, divine focuses, and focuses that wouldn’t fit in a pouch.

While it specifies focuses it is pretty logical that this "size" issue applies to any component.
